526154486323 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 526154486324. Its totient is φ = 526154486322.
The previous prime is 526154486267. The next prime is 526154486339. The reversal of 526154486323 is 323684451625.
It is a strong pr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is a de Polignac number, because none of the positive numbers 2k-526154486323 is a prime.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(526154486423)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 263077243161 + 263077243162.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(263077243162).
Almost surely, 2526154486323 is an apocalyptic number.
526154486323 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
526154486323 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
526154486323 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The product of its digits is 4147200, while the sum is 49.
The spelling of 526154486323 in words is "five hundred twenty-six billion, one hundred fifty-four million, four hundred eighty-six thousand, three hundred twenty-three".
